Output 3a9084d7778a2aebc3f5a6a2710fd90f3405a8bffa1b2fa8a58330942104a2bc:0

value
108572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89bcf876ab61f21c7b88851206d2de02e6cb0bd0 OP_EQUAL
address
3EFJsjFW2FhLtUn1d9c1FLSFk9rYruLS36
transaction
3a9084d7778a2aebc3f5a6a2710fd90f3405a8bffa1b2fa8a58330942104a2bc
spent
true